    The demand for high-quality audio has grown tremendously, and with it, the phrase “youtube to flac” has become one of the most searched terms among music enthusiasts and editors. At its core, converting YouTube content to FLAC means extracting audio from a YouTube video and saving it as a lossless file.

    This concept appeals to users who want to preserve audio quality for editing, archiving, or audiophile listening. However, many people still misunderstand what this conversion actually delivers. FLAC ensures that whatever audio YouTube provides is saved without additional compression loss, but it does not magically improve the source quality.

    This guide breaks down everything you need to know—from legality to tools, from quality expectations to best practices—so you can safely and efficiently convert YouTube videos to FLAC while maintaining the highest possible audio fidelity.

    What Is FLAC?

    FLAC, which stands for Free Lossless Audio Codec, is a format designed to compress audio without losing any of the original data. Unlike MP3, AAC, or other lossy formats, FLAC preserves every detail from the source audio, making it perfect for listeners who are serious about sound.

    The biggest advantage of FLAC is that it reduces file size while keeping the audio bit-for-bit identical to the original. This makes it ideal for collecting, archiving, editing, and enjoying music at its fullest quality. Music producers, DJs, and sound engineers rely on FLAC files because editing lossy formats repeatedly degrades the audio. With FLAC, quality stays intact no matter how many times the file is processed.

    When we talk about youtube to flac, it means you are saving the audio in a lossless manner, ensuring the best possible result from the YouTube stream.

    Is Converting YouTube to FLAC Worth It?

    A common misunderstanding is that converting a YouTube video to FLAC automatically enhances audio quality. It does not. YouTube compresses all uploaded audio using either AAC or Opus codecs. This means the audio is already lossy before you convert it. When you convert YouTube to FLAC, you are simply preserving the quality of the YouTube audio stream without degrading it further.

    This has several benefits: editors can work with the file without losing any more detail, archivists can store the audio in a future-proof format, and audiophiles can maintain consistent audio quality across their libraries. If the video contains high-quality audio originally uploaded at a high bitrate, a FLAC conversion preserves that level. If the video has poor sound, converting it to FLAC won’t fix it—but it does prevent any additional loss.

    Is It Legal to Convert YouTube Videos to FLAC?

    Before jumping into tools, it’s important to understand the legal side of youtube to flac conversions. YouTube’s Terms of Service clearly state that downloading videos or audio is not allowed unless the platform specifically provides a download button or the content is licensed for free use. This means that converting copyrighted music, movie scenes, and commercial content is not legally permitted unless you have explicit permission.

    However, converting public domain content, Creative Commons-licensed videos, or your own uploaded content is allowed. Many users convert audio for personal, offline use, but even this sits in a grey area legally. The safest approach is to ensure you have the rights to the content you are converting. Ethical use is crucial because creators rely on ad revenue and licensing. Always respect copyright guidelines while performing any YouTube to FLAC conversions.

    Best YouTube to FLAC Converters (2025 Updated)

    The internet is full of tools claiming to convert YouTube to flac, but not all are safe or reliable. Some bombard users with ads, malware, or fake download buttons. To stay on the safe side, it’s best to choose reputable tools. Converters fall into three main categories: online converters, desktop software, and command-line tools.

    Online converters are convenient and require no installation. Desktop applications provide better stability, higher speed, and more customization options. Command-line tools, particularly yt-dlp, offer unmatched control and quality extraction for advanced users. Below, we break down the most trusted options.

    Top Online YouTube to FLAC Converters

    Online converters are the easiest way to turn YouTube to FLAC because they require no downloads, but choosing the right one matters. The best tools offer fast conversion, clean interfaces, no misleading ads, and support for long videos. Many online converters also allow users to choose additional formats like WAV, MP3, or M4A. However, online tools come with limitations.

    They often restrict video length, may throttle high-quality processing, and can be slower during peak times. Another concern is privacy: when you paste a link into an online converter, your usage is logged by the service. Despite these downsides, online converters remain the preferred choice for casual users who want quick and simple FLAC files without installing software.

    Best Desktop Software to Convert YouTube to FLAC

    Desktop applications offer more control, faster conversion, and higher reliability than browser-based solutions. Tools like MediaHuman, 4K Video Downloader, and NoteBurner provide stable performance with features including batch downloading, metadata editing, and format customization. These are extremely helpful if you frequently convert youtube to flac or if you require audio for professional editing.

    Desktop programs typically avoid the limitations of online tools, such as file size caps or bandwidth restrictions. They are especially useful for converting long videos, podcasts, lectures, or entire playlists. For users who want consistent, high-quality results with minimal risk, desktop software is often the best solution.

    How to Convert YouTube to FLAC Using yt-dlp (For Experts)

    For advanced users, yt-dlp is the most powerful tool available for youtube to flac conversions. It allows you to choose the highest-quality audio stream from YouTube and convert it using FFmpeg’s lossless encoding. A simple command such as:

    yt-dlp -x --audio-format flac <YouTube-URL>

    automatically extracts and converts audio to FLAC. You can also specify format priorities, embed metadata, take thumbnails as cover art, and choose custom filenames.

    This tool is ideal for developers, audio engineers, or anyone who prefers precision and full control over the conversion process. While the learning curve is slightly higher, yt-dlp provides unmatched flexibility and remains the most trusted option among power users.

    Quality Considerations in YouTube → FLAC Conversion

    When converting YouTube to FLAC, the source quality is the most important factor. YouTube serves audio in different bitrates depending on the video resolution, device, and upload quality. For example, newer videos often use the Opus codec at bitrates ranging from 96 kbps to 160 kbps, while older videos may rely on AAC streams. Converting these streams to FLAC preserves the waveform exactly as received from YouTube but does not improve detail.

    Another important consideration is FLAC compression level. FLAC offers compression levels from 0 (fastest) to 8 (smallest file). Higher levels reduce file size but do not change audio quality. Users who want fast conversion should choose lower compression, while archivists may prefer higher compression for long-term storage.

    Common Issues & How to Fix Them

    People converting youtube to flac often encounter common problems such as poor audio quality, incomplete downloads, broken metadata, or extremely large files. If the FLAC file sounds bad, the issue is usually with the YouTube source itself—try finding a higher-quality upload. If files are too large, reduce the FLAC compression level or remove unnecessary metadata.

    For metadata issues, use an audio tagging tool to manually add titles, artists, and cover art. If online converters produce errors or timeouts, switching to desktop software or yt-dlp usually solves the problem. Understanding these issues helps ensure smooth, frustration-free conversions.

    Safety Tips When Using YouTube to FLAC Converters

    Safety should always come first when converting content online. Avoid websites with aggressive ads, pop-ups, or instant executable downloads. A trustworthy youtube to flac converter should never ask you to install random extensions or additional software. Always use HTTPS-secured websites and scan downloaded files for malware.

    Desktop tools should be downloaded only from official websites, not from third-party hosting sites. When using online converters, avoid entering personal information. Protecting your device and privacy is just as important as achieving good audio quality.

    Alternative Lossless Audio Formats You Can Use

    Although FLAC is the most popular lossless format, it is not the only one. WAV is a raw, uncompressed format used extensively in studios, though its file sizes are much larger. ALAC (Apple Lossless Audio Codec) is perfect for Apple users because it integrates seamlessly with iTunes and Apple Music.

    AIFF is another uncompressed format similar to WAV, but it supports metadata better. Depending on your use case—editing, archiving, or listening—you may choose one of these formats instead of FLAC. However, for general users converting YouTube to FLAC, FLAC remains the best balance of quality, efficiency, and compatibility.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Does FLAC improve audio quality?
    No. FLAC preserves quality; it does not enhance it.

    What’s the highest audio quality on YouTube?
    Typically 160 kbps Opus for most videos, but quality varies based on the uploader.

    Can FLAC files play on phones?
    Yes, most Android and many iOS apps support FLAC playback.

    Is YouTube to FLAC legal?
    Only if you have rights or the content is licensed for free use.
